The Cabernets of Domaine de l’Arjolle - Côtes de Thongue

Cabernet Domaine de l'Arjolle

This almost dark wine is made of both Cabernets grown at the Domaine de l’Arjolle, C. franc and C. sauvignon. The aromas of the wine emphasizes why I love those grape varieties: leather, cassis and elder berries, together with something slightly herbaceous. You could call it green pepper, but to me the odor is somehow more ladylike, reminding more of slightly sweet and spicy chilies.

Sweetness, that’s also what dominates on the palate, together with fresh acidity. Light-hearted, smooth, youthful and a handful of fine tannins and smoke towards the end.

I like those dark and smoky wines in autumn, during winter, in the evening, in front of the chimney, when it gets cold and dark outside and misty humidity crawls out of the woods and the fields.
